It particularly applies to abdominal aortic aneurysm repair. A first 3D volume scan of the stent in situ is provided and a second, subsequent 3D volume scan of the stent is also provided. One or more fiducial markers are generated in a first image derived from the first scan and in a second image derived from the second scan. The fiducial markers identify recognizable features of the stent, such as the bifurcation point in the stent graft. A rigid 3D transform mapping based on the one or more fiducial markers is extracted and then a registration is applied to the first and second scans based on the 3D rigid transform between the first and second images. A size value is derived at the same location in the aneurysm from the first and second scans. The same location is determined with reference to the registered first and second images of the stent. A comparison of the size value from the first and second scans is used to assess a change in size of the aneurysm between the first and second scans. This change in size allows the clinician to evaluate disease progression."},"analysis":{"summary":null,"layman_explanation":null,"technical_analysis":null,"business_analysis":null,"faqs":null,"topics":[],"tech_cluster":null},"seo":{"title":"Imaging method, controller and imaging system, for monitoring a patient post EVAR","description":"The invention provides a method of patient monitoring following endovascular aneurysm repair (EVAR) with a stent graft.
